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Drainage of Rathangan River.

asked the Minister for Finance if he will state whether the Rathangan River is included in any, and, if so, in what catchment area for treatment under the Arterial Drainage Act and, if included, when the drainage of the area will be undertaken.

As Istated during the debate on the Estimate for Vote 9, and in reply to the recent Private Members' motion regarding the River Nore, the survey commitments of the Commissioners of Public Works will take a period of at least two years to clear. When those commitments have been cleared, the Barrow catchment area, in which the Rathangan River is situated, will be considered on its merits in conjunction with some 20 other major catchments requiring attention.
